Support using custom rustflags for targets

This is necessary for AVR and AMDGPU. We currently just hardcode some
flags in the binary, which is good enough. There's a new column which
keeps track of the used flags and shows them for a build.

A migration makes sure that the older results are properly backfilled
with the flags to make them build.
